@registeragent/core
v0.1.1
Published
Shared types, constants, and error classes for the Autonomous Identity Protocol
Downloads
29
Readme
@registeragent/core
Shared types, constants, and error classes for the Autonomous Identity Protocol.
Install
npm install @registeragent/coreExports
Types: AipIdentity, AipTokenClaims, AipClientAssertionClaims, AipTokenResponse, AipEntityStatus, AipIssuerDiscovery, AipMerchantDiscovery, Result
Enums: EntityStatus, OwnerStatus
Constants: AIP_ALGORITHM, AIP_CURVE, TOKEN_TTL_SECONDS, ASSERTION_MAX_TTL_SECONDS, METADATA_MAX_BYTES, JWKS_CACHE_TTL_MS, TOKEN_REFRESH_INTERVAL_MS, AIP_CLAIMS, WELL_KNOWN, DEFAULT_ASSURANCE
Error classes: AipError, AipTokenExpiredError, AipTokenInvalidError, AipSignatureError, AipAudienceMismatchError, AipIssuerMismatchError, AipEntityNotFoundError, AipEntityRevokedError, AipEntitySuspendedError, AipAssertionInvalidError, AipJwksFetchError, AipMetadataTooLargeError, AipRateLimitedError
Zod schemas: aipTokenClaimsSchema, aipClientAssertionClaimsSchema, tokenRequestSchema, createEntitySchema, updateEntitySchema, aipIssuerDiscoverySchema, aipMerchantDiscoverySchema
Links
License
MIT
